📖 Uncategorized

Brief Task Description- You must design and implement a library search system allowing users to search for books by title. Itshould also allow adding new books and removing lost/damaged books from the library system.

GE GeekScholars Expert · 📅 1 May 2026 · ⏱ 1 min read
🎓 Need help with your assignment? Get expert quotes in minutes — free to submit, no commitment. ✍️ Get Writing Help FREE

1 Brief Task DescriptionYou must design and implement a library search system allowing users to search for books by title. Itshould also allow adding new books and removing lost/damaged books from the library system. Asthe library will have millions of books, you should think about the most appropriate data structure(s)and algorithms for the search; add and remove functionality. During the design phase, you shouldanalyse the algorithms for searching for a book, adding a book and removing a book from thesystem. You should not use any third party libraries or code as a part of your solution and all codeshould be written by you, i.e. not automatically generated. You also shouldn't use non-standard oroperating system dependant libraries in your program (the code should all be standard C++). Toachieve a good mark, you should design and implement the data structures yourself. Using standardtemplate library (STL) data structures will severely limit the grade you can achieve.2 SubmissionYou must submit a single zip file of all required source code; a single PDF report and a videodemonstration of the software by Friday, 11th April 2021. The source code zip file should include: 'C++ source code files of your program• catch2 test code• a Makefile to rnmnile vnur nrnpram The renort must he nn longer than R napes (including

Expert Academic Help

Get Expert Help With Your Assignment — On Your Terms

  • All subjects — UK, USA & Australia specialists
  • 100% Original — Plagiarism report on request
  • Deadline from 3 hours
  • Unlimited free revisions
  • Free to submit — compare quotes
GE
Written by
GeekScholars Expert

Academic writing specialist and subject matter expert at GeekScholars. Helping students achieve their best academic results since 2018.

Still Struggling With Your Assignment?

Our expert writers are ready. Submit your brief now — free, confidential, and with quotes arriving in minutes.

Place My Order Free

🔒 Confidential  ·  ✅ Plagiarism-Free  ·  ⚡ Fast Delivery